The Beach as an Extension of Daily Living

When the beach is close to home, it becomes part of regular life rather than a special destination. Short drives or easy access make it simple to enjoy morning walks along the shore, sunset views after work, or spontaneous weekend outings. This accessibility encourages residents to take advantage of the coast more often and in more meaningful ways.

Regular exposure to coastal environments supports relaxation and stress reduction. The sights and sounds of the shoreline create a calming effect that many people find restorative, helping to balance busy schedules and responsibilities.

Supporting Active and Healthy Lifestyles

Beach living naturally promotes physical activity. Walking on sand, swimming, paddle sports, and shoreline cycling all contribute to fitness without the structure of traditional exercise routines. These activities are accessible to a wide range of ages and fitness levels, making them easy to enjoy consistently.

Communities located near the coast make it easier for residents to stay active year-round. When outdoor recreation is convenient, people are more likely to maintain healthy habits without needing memberships or long commutes.

Enhancing Social and Family Experiences

The beach often serves as a gathering place for families and friends. Picnics, group walks, and shared outings create opportunities for connection and quality time. Living near the coast allows residents to host visitors and enjoy shared experiences without extensive planning.

These moments strengthen relationships and create lasting memories. The ability to enjoy casual, unplanned beach time adds flexibility and enjoyment to both everyday life and special occasions.

Mental Well-Being and Coastal Environments

Natural coastal settings provide mental health benefits that extend beyond physical activity. Time spent near the ocean is associated with reduced stress, improved mood, and enhanced focus. The open views and natural rhythms of the shoreline offer a sense of perspective that many people find grounding.

Living near the beach allows residents to incorporate these benefits into their routines. Even short visits can provide a mental reset that supports overall well-being.
